Q: Is 2,427,135 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,427,135 is a composite number.

Why is 2,427,135 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,427,135 can be evenly divided by 1 3 5 15 43 53 71 129 159 213 215 265 355 645 795 1,065 2,279 3,053 3,763 6,837 9,159 11,289 11,395 15,265 18,815 34,185 45,795 56,445 161,809 485,427 809,045 and 2,427,135, with no remainder.

Since 2,427,135 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,427,135, it is a composite number.
